Sign In — Free (10 views/day)EcoWorks, founded in 1981, is a community nonprofit in the Housing & Shelter sector that reported $1.9M in total revenue in fiscal year 2022. Revenue decreased 5% compared to the prior year. The organization ran a surplus of $311K, a strong 17% operating margin.
EcoWorks creates opportunities to learn and practice the sustainable use of energy and natural resources.
